About azane;dicarboxy carbonate;zinc
azane;dicarboxy carbonate;zinc (PubChem CID 174882061) has the molecular formula C3H8N2O7Zn2
and a molecular weight of 314.88 g/mol. Its IUPAC name is azane;dicarboxy carbonate;zinc.
